Orientation
Power Status Switch Position Indicator Light
Power OFF Switch OFF No Lights
Standby Mode Switch ON Power indicator ON,
all other indicators OFF
Power ON Switch ON + ON signal from remote Power Indicator OFF,
Volume / Source indicators ON
NOTE: To reduce
unwanted vibration,
try placing the
subwoofer on a
solid or padded
surface, such as the
floor or carpet.
For most instances, leave the switch in the ON position, the system will be
in Standby Mode. It is not necessary to use the Main Power Switch every time.
Use the remote to fully power ON and begin listening to audio.
Use the remote again to place the system back in Standby Mode.
